From the start Biopackaging was at the forefront of design and development of UN/IATA compliant packaging. The Blue Lid Biobottle was the first such product developed to meet the regulations and through constant development has remained the market leader in sales and quality.
Biopackaging has a strong record of partnership with the NHS and other governmental departments and agencies. As well as providing a steady supply of products to the public sector.
Biopackaging, working closely with DEFRA, was integral in providing transport solutions during the outbreak of BSE (Bovine Spongiform Encephalitis, or “Mad Cow Disease”), Biopackaging is also a preferred supplier during emergency conditions such as the Swine Flu Pandemic, during which time our range of products were the most extensively used packaging solutions.

Bio-Packaging Ltd specialises in intelligent, innovative and standards-compliant transport packaging solutions.
Our UN3373, UN2814 (Category A), UN2900 (Category A), UN 3291 (Category B), ADR & IATA compliant product range provides cost effective flexible transport packaging solutions for a range of Hazardous, Infectious and Diagnostic specimens of all sizes.
